According to Datamonitor's eHealth Consumer Insight Survey, consumers in the US, Western EU and Japan access search engines more frequently than any other type of online or offline information resource when looking for health information. As a result, consumers' requests for medication based on information obtained online have become an increasingly influential factor in the prescribing process.

Research and Anaylsis Highlights
Consumers have come to rely heavily on the thoughts and experiences had by others, which are often shared via various types of online forums (i.e., message boards, blogs and chat rooms).
While physicians report that television and print ads remain the mediums with the most influence on patients, online channels such as disease-focused websites, are gaining ground in key markets.
Convincing users to frequently return to a website entails all of the marketing practices employed to get them there initially, plus requires that the website in question meets one or more of consumers' ongoing needs.
